Miami rookie Tyler Herro's 27 points included a go-ahead three-pointer with 38.2 seconds remaining in overtime Sunday in the Heat's 110-105 NBA victory over the Chicago Bulls. Herro's heroics included a three-pointer with 7.1 seconds left in regulation, which ended with the score tied at 97-97. He made three more from beyond the arc in the extra session as the Heat improved to 10-0 at home this season and 17-6 overall.
